Simon handles Moya, repeats as BCR Open Romania champ

Presented by Epson

BUCHAREST, Romania -- Gilles Simon of France won his second straight BCR Open Romania by beating Carlos Moya 6-3, 6-4 in Sunday's final.

The second-seeded Simon broke the Spaniard at 3-2 in the first set and saved all six break points he conceded in the match to secure his fifth career title.

The final only lasted about 90 minutes, just half the time it took Simon to defeat eighth-seeded Jose Acasuso of Argentina in Saturday's semifinal. Simon beat local favorite Victor Hanescu in last year's final, and has an 11-1 record in Bucharest.
